What is the meaning behind the song holy by Florida Georgia Line?

SONG MEANING: “H.O.L.Y." by Florida Georgia Line is about a woman; the song describes her using religious imagery to suggest that there is something very special about the love being described here and that she may be better than actual religion.

What is Florida Georgia Line best song?

1. "Cruise" One cannot think about Florida Georgia Line's discography without mentioning the song that started it all for them -- "Cruise." This first single, which remains their biggest hit to date, introduced the duo way back in 2012 on their debut album Here's To The Good Times.

What was the first Florida Georgia Line song?

"Cruise", the first single, reached number one on the Country Airplay chart dated December 15, 2012. A remix of "Cruise" featuring Nelly later hit number four on the US Billboard Hot 100.
